MULTAN: In a solemn event organized by the Sha’oor Taraqiyati Organization, Awaz Foundation, and Civil Society Forum (CSF), prominent speakers termed the tragic incident at the Army Public School (APS) as the darkest day in the history of Pakistan.

The aim of the event was to observe the ninth anniversary of the APS attack that left more than 147 people, mostly children, martyred and stressed the importance of unity in confronting the threats posed by extremism and terrorism.

Key speakers at the event, including Shahid Mahmood Ansari, Farah Malik, Chaudhry Mansoor Advocate, and others, came together to pay tribute to the martyrs of the APS attack. They expressed unwavering solidarity with the families who lost their loved ones in the tragic incident.

Moreover, a candlelight prayer ceremony was held at Pakistan Baitul Mal Sweet Home, attracting a significant number of participating children. Civil society activists addressed the ceremony, acknowledging the role of security forces in the ongoing fight against terrorism.

The speakers urged for a united front against extremism, emphasizing its importance in achieving long-lasting peace in the region.
